Faster, Smarter Shooting Data 00:00 Introduction 00:10 Overview of the Garmin Xero Chronograph 00:24 What’s New with the C2 00:48 Smartwatch Integration Feature 01:24 App Connectivity and Data Management 01:39 Faster Processor and Shot Detection 02:22 Accuracy Comparison Test 03:12 Standard vs C2 Performance 03:47 Rapid Fire Testing 05:11 Full Magazine Test Results 05:23 Session Pause and Resume Feature 05:44 Final Performance Summary 06:22 Final Thoughts In this video, Caleb and Steve take a look at the new Garmin Xero C2 chronograph and compare it directly to the original model. They test accuracy, shot detection, and performance during both slow and rapid fire to see how the upgraded processor handles real-world use. The C2 brings faster shot registration, improved tracking during rapid fire, and seamless integration with Garmin smartwatches, allowing shooters to monitor velocity data in real time without being tied to the bench. If you are building dope cards, tracking velocity, or refining your ballistic data, this chronograph offers a modern, efficient way to collect and manage shooting data.
